The City of Lansing Façade Improvement Program is deigned to strengthen the economic viability of Lansing’s commercial corridors by providing targeted assistance for improving the appearance and structural conditions of buildings in highly visible and critical areas of the city.

The purpose of this program is to assist with aesthetic beauty, safety improvements as well as enhance the street appearance of Lansing businesses. Because of this program, Lansing properties have become more attractive to customers and the community as well as increasing the overall value of local businesses.
This Façade Improvement Program, along with other available incentives and programs, will begin to reinforce Lansing’s commercial corridors in both appearance and structure and will set the stage for further development. However, the ultimate success of Lansing’s commercial corridors is dependent upon the level of private sector commitment. It is up to the merchants, building owners, residents, professionals and investors to improve the mechanics of their businesses and the condition of their buildings.
Grant Types
- Transformational Grant – Up to $30,000.
- For façade projects totaling $10,000 and above, grant funds will provide a “dollar for dollar” match (50% of the total project cost) up to a maximum $30,000 award.
- Aesthetic & Maintenance Grant – up to $10,000.
- For façade projects with a total cost under $10,000, grant funds will provide a “dollar for dollar” match (50% of the total project cost) up to a maximum $5,000 award.
- Design Program Award – Up to $2,000.
- This award is for development of renderings/façade designs and material specifications to assist with potential upfront design costs to prepare for future façade improvements. Offers up to a $2,000 award value per applicant (total of $10,000 available in this category) in the form of design services by a firm selected and/or approved by the Facade Committee and LEDC.
Eligibility Criteria
Property owners, tenants and others are eligible to apply for grant funds; however, the applicants must provide proof of ownership. Applicants may have no liabilities, or past/present obligations to the City of Lansing, including and especially any back taxes. If the applicant is not the owner, a notarized letter of permission from the property owner is acceptable along with proof of the owner’s legitimate ownership interest in the property. The Façade Design Committee reserves the right to approve grant funds on a case-by-case-basis.
